I tried to order some Fusable Links (for the glowplus) part number S10L67099 from Mazda and was told that they are no longer available.
That is that sorted then,next.g8dhe wrote:I'm sure there probably is but I've never seen a specification for the fusible link other than "1.25sq".
If we assume that this is 1.25sq mm than that is equivalent to 16AWG or 17swg wire which is rated for 25 Amps continuous carrying capacity.
Now if we look up the common glowplug used NGK Y-701 the spec given is http://www.ngk.com.au/glow-plugs/techni ... plug-types
Which doesn't specifically say what the current drawn is but indicates that peak is about 18Amps (each) and it settles down to 8Amps (each) so we could be looking at around 32Amps.
So it would appear that we would be in the right ball-park for a fusible link to be rated at 25Amps meaning 16awg wire, these links are designed to blow VERY slowly taking several seconds to reach melting point - unlike normal fuses which are designed to heat up and melt in the order of 100's of milliseconds.
So I think I would look to use a 2-3" length of 16AWG or 17SWG copper wire (insulated, non-flammable) if making it myself. Possibly replacing the connector with a Yellow bullet type connectors which should have an adequate current rating, Blue coloured connectors would be a better size fit for the wire but I would be a little suspect of there current carrying capacity.
